Haryana Staff Selection Commission will close the HSSC CET Group D Recruitment 2026 registration process on July 05, 2026. Eligible candidates can submit their applications for more than 8,000 Group D vacancies before the application window closes. The correction facility will remain available from July 07 to July 09, 2026.
HSSC CET Group D Recruitment 2026 registration will close today, July 05, 2026, for candidates seeking admission to more than 8,000 Group D posts in various Haryana Government departments. The Haryana Staff Selection Commission (HSSC) is accepting online applications through its official portal. Eligible candidates who have not yet completed the registration process should submit their application before the deadline to avoid last-minute technical issues. The recruitment drive covers posts such as Peon, Helper, Chowkidar, Mali, and other Group D positions across different state departments.
HSSC CET Group D Recruitment 2026 Last Date and Important Updates
The HSSC CET Group D Recruitment 2026 application process began on June 19, 2026, and concluded on July 05, 2026. After the registration process closes, candidates will be allowed to edit their submitted application forms during the correction window.

HSSC CET Group D Recruitment 2026 Selection Process
The HSSC CET Group D Selection Process 2026 is based on the Common Eligibility Test conducted by the commission. Candidates securing the required qualifying score will be considered for further recruitment according to merit and applicable reservation rules. The recruitment process generally includes:
- Common Eligibility Test (CET)
- Merit preparation based on CET score
- Document Verification
- Final appointment by the concerned department
